What type of construction relies on external bracing?

Tube construction is characterized by its reliance on external bracing for structural support. This type of construction uses a system of tubular columns and beams that create a framework around the building. The external bracing provides stability and allows for the design to be highly efficient with the use of materials while also maximizing the interior space. This approach is particularly beneficial in high-rise buildings, where stability is crucial to withstand lateral forces such as wind and seismic activity. The external bracing not only adds strength but also contributes to the aesthetic appeal of modern architecture, allowing for open and flexible interior designs.

In contrast, portal construction involves a series of rigid frames that are typically used for structures like warehouses and industrial buildings, relying primarily on the strength of the frame rather than external bracing. Frame construction is associated with the use of timber or steel frames that provide internal bracing, while panel construction typically involves pre-fabricated panels that form the walls and exterior of a building without extensive external supports. Therefore, tube construction’s defining feature of using external bracing sets it apart from these other types of construction.
